Duties
Assist in the preparation and maintenance of the general and supplementary valuation rolls i.e the Municipal Property Rates Act No.6 of 2004 (MPRA) Administer and coordinate valuation-related processes in compliance with the MPRA, including providing administrative support for property valuation objections, appeals, and related statutory functions. Assist with verification of certain component of the Fixed Asset Register and maintenance thereof. Provide Market Valuations for the Disposal Acquisition, Rental and Investment of Immovable Properties for Municipal Purposes. Provide enhanced process optimization, efficiency and continuous improvement within valuation section. Undertake specific tasks associated with all aspect of property valuations, including property market research and the physical attributes of property. Engage relevant stakeholders and represent the Valuations section on property valuation matters. Assist in spatial analysis of maps for the study areas and update GIS systems in respect of sub-divisions, rezoning and consolidations. Compile, analyse and submit accurate, reliable and timeous reports to support management decision-making, statutory compliance, and operational performance monitoring.
